Uses of Interface
com.broadleafcommerce.cartoperation.service.provider.CatalogProvider
-
-
Uses of CatalogProvider in com.broadleafcommerce.cartoperation.service
Methods in com.broadleafcommerce.cartoperation.service that return CatalogProvider Modifier and Type Method Description protected CatalogProvider<? extends CatalogItem>DefaultItemListItemMergingService. getCatalogProvider()protected CatalogProvider<? extends CatalogItem>DefaultStaleCartItemsService. getCatalogProvider()Methods in com.broadleafcommerce.cartoperation.service with parameters of type CatalogProvider Modifier and Type Method Description voidDefaultStaleCartItemsService. setCatalogProvider(CatalogProvider<? extends CatalogItem> catalogProvider)Constructors in com.broadleafcommerce.cartoperation.service with parameters of type CatalogProvider Constructor Description DefaultItemListItemMergingService(@NonNull CatalogProvider<? extends CatalogItem> catalogProvider, @NonNull CartOperationServiceProperties properties) -
Uses of CatalogProvider in com.broadleafcommerce.cartoperation.service.checkout.workflow.activity
Methods in com.broadleafcommerce.cartoperation.service.checkout.workflow.activity that return CatalogProvider Modifier and Type Method Description protected CatalogProvider<? extends CatalogItem>CartItemValidationActivity. getCatalogProvider()Constructors in com.broadleafcommerce.cartoperation.service.checkout.workflow.activity with parameters of type CatalogProvider Constructor Description CartItemValidationActivity(CatalogProvider<? extends CatalogItem> catalogProvider, CartItemConfigurationService<? extends CatalogItem> cartItemConfigurationService, org.springframework.context.MessageSource messageSource) -
Uses of CatalogProvider in com.broadleafcommerce.cartoperation.service.configuration
Methods in com.broadleafcommerce.cartoperation.service.configuration that return CatalogProvider Modifier and Type Method Description protected CatalogProvider<? extends CatalogItem>DefaultCartItemConfigurationService. getCatalogProvider()Deprecated.This implementation does not useDefaultCartItemConfigurationService.catalogProviderConstructors in com.broadleafcommerce.cartoperation.service.configuration with parameters of type CatalogProvider Constructor Description DefaultCartItemConfigurationService(CatalogProvider<? extends CatalogItem> catalogProvider, IncludedProductConfigurationService includedProductService, ItemChoiceConfigurationService itemChoiceService, AttributeChoiceConfigurationService attributeChoiceService, org.springframework.context.MessageSource messageSource, com.broadleafcommerce.common.extension.TypeFactory typeFactory) -
Uses of CatalogProvider in com.broadleafcommerce.cartoperation.service.mapping
Methods in com.broadleafcommerce.cartoperation.service.mapping that return CatalogProvider Modifier and Type Method Description protected CatalogProvider<? extends CatalogItem>DataDrivenCartItemProductMapper. getCatalogProvider()Constructors in com.broadleafcommerce.cartoperation.service.mapping with parameters of type CatalogProvider Constructor Description DataDrivenCartItemProductMapper(com.fasterxml.jackson.databind.ObjectMapper objectMapper, CatalogProvider<? extends CatalogItem> catalogProvider) -
Uses of CatalogProvider in com.broadleafcommerce.cartoperation.service.pricing
Methods in com.broadleafcommerce.cartoperation.service.pricing that return CatalogProvider Modifier and Type Method Description protected CatalogProvider<? extends CatalogItem>DefaultCartPricingService. getCatalogProvider()Constructors in com.broadleafcommerce.cartoperation.service.pricing with parameters of type CatalogProvider Constructor Description DefaultCartPricingService(CartItemPricingUtils cartItemPricingUtils, CartProvider cartProvider, PricingProvider pricingProvider, OfferProvider offerProvider, CatalogProvider<? extends CatalogItem> catalogProvider, CartItemConfigurationService<? extends CatalogItem> cartItemConfigurationService, TaxService taxService, FulfillmentPricingService fulfillmentPricingService, com.fasterxml.jackson.databind.ObjectMapper objectMapper, CartTotalsCalculator cartTotalsCalculator, CartPricingRoundingHelper roundingHelper, CartOperationServiceProperties cartOperationServiceProperties, com.broadleafcommerce.common.extension.TypeFactory typeFactory, org.springframework.context.MessageSource messageSource)DefaultCartPricingService(CartItemPricingUtils cartItemPricingUtils, CartProvider cartProvider, PricingProvider pricingProvider, OfferProvider offerProvider, CatalogProvider<? extends CatalogItem> catalogProvider, TaxService taxService, FulfillmentPricingService fulfillmentPricingService, com.fasterxml.jackson.databind.ObjectMapper objectMapper, CartTotalsCalculator cartTotalsCalculator, CartPricingRoundingHelper roundingHelper, CartOperationServiceProperties cartOperationServiceProperties, com.broadleafcommerce.common.extension.TypeFactory typeFactory, org.springframework.context.MessageSource messageSource) -
Uses of CatalogProvider in com.broadleafcommerce.cartoperation.service.provider
Methods in com.broadleafcommerce.cartoperation.service.provider that return CatalogProvider Modifier and Type Method Description CatalogProvider<? extends CatalogItem>CartOperationServiceProviders. getCatalogProvider()Gets a catalog provider.CatalogProvider<? extends CatalogItem>DefaultCartOperationServiceProviders. getCatalogProvider()Constructors in com.broadleafcommerce.cartoperation.service.provider with parameters of type CatalogProvider Constructor Description DefaultCartOperationServiceProviders(CartProvider cartProvider, CatalogProvider<? extends CatalogItem> catalogProvider, OfferProvider offerProvider, CampaignProvider campaignProvider, InventoryProvider inventoryProvider) -
Uses of CatalogProvider in com.broadleafcommerce.cartoperation.service.provider.external
Classes in com.broadleafcommerce.cartoperation.service.provider.external that implement CatalogProvider Modifier and Type Class Description classExternalCatalogProvider<I extends CatalogItem>This particular implementation ofCatalogProvideris designed to interact with a provider that will provide fully hydrated catalog entities, i.e., there is no need for additional calls to get a product's variants or item choices.
-